HP Telecom India IPO open date is February 20, 2025, and the IPO will close on February 24, 2025. HP Telecom India IPO is a Fixed Price Issue. The company aims to raise ₹34.23 crores via IPO, comprising a fresh issue of ₹34.23 crores. HP Telecom India IPO price is set at ₹108 per share. The retail quota is 50%, QIB is 0%, and HNI is 50%. HP Telecom India IPO is set to list on NSE on February 28, 2025. The allotment date is February 25, 2025. The company reported revenue of ₹1,079.77 crores in 2024, up from ₹638.47 crores in 2023. About HP Telecom India IPO
HP Telecom India Limited, established in March 2011, provides mobile phones and accessories. In 2014-15, the company obtained exclusive distribution rights for Sony LED TVs, mobile phones, and other brands in Gujarat. The directors of HP Telecom India Limited include Vijay Lalsingh Yadav, Seemabahen Vijay Yadav, Bharatlal Lalsingh Singh, Dinesh Ram Nath Yadav, Chirag Jitendra Sheth, Hemant Ashwinkumar Jethwa, and Barkha Jain. During 2015-16, the company expanded its distribution portfolio by securing exclusive rights to distribute Jio products as the West Region Trade Partner for Gujarat. The company is exploring new product lines, including brands like Nokia, Micro Max, Intex, Gionee, and Karbonn Mobiles. As of 2024, the company has 7 permanent employees and 84 contract-based employees.
